Electrical Design Team
Our electrical design team is a skilled group of electrical engineering technologists. We design custom electrical control systems and industrial control panels to North American and European standards, UL508A, CSA C22.2 No. 286, and CE. Our work includes detailed schematic creation, accurate panel footprint layouts, and project reports to support each stage of development.

Our team sets up vision systems, including various vision inspection and barcode reading applications. We specialize in all forms of industrial robots, including traditional, collaborative, Autonomous Mobile Robots (AMRs), and Automated Guided Vehicles (AGVs). We also develop SCADA applications using SIMATIC WinCC, Rockwell Automation FactoryTalk View SE, and Ignition by Inductive Automation. We create custom test applications with LabVIEW.
